### API Design: Crafting Seamless Communication
API design is a critical aspect of software development that ensures different software systems can communicate effectively. Following REST API best practices is essential for creating intuitive and efficient interfaces. RESTful APIs have become the standard due to their stateless operations and support for HTTP methods such as GET, POST, PUT, and DELETE. By adhering to REST API best practices, developers can build scalable, maintainable, and secure APIs that enhance user experience and facilitate seamless integration with other services.
### Microservices: Building Modular Systems
Microservices architecture has revolutionized the way applications are designed and deployed. Unlike monolithic architectures, microservices break down applications into smaller, independent services that can be developed, deployed, and scaled individually. This granular approach allows for greater flexibility, enabling teams to work on different components simultaneously without affecting the overall system. As a result, microservices enhance fault tolerance and make it easier to implement continuous integration and continuous deployment (CI/CD) pipelines.
### Authentication Systems: Ensuring Secure Access
Authentication systems are pivotal in securing applications and protecting user data. Implementing robust authentication mechanisms, such as OAuth, OpenID Connect, and JSON Web Tokens (JWT), is essential for safeguarding sensitive information. By leveraging these technologies, developers can ensure that only authorized users have access to specific resources, thereby maintaining the integrity and confidentiality of the application.
